Does the 2014 Volkswagen Passat have fuel/propulsion system problems?
Fuel/propulsion System is the #5 most-reported problem area on the 2014 Volkswagen Passat: 47 of 592 complaints on file (7.9%). Complaints are unverified owner reports, not confirmed defects.
How many complaints does the 2014 Volkswagen Passat have in total?
592 complaints were on file with NHTSA as of 07/12/2026. Across all categories, 18 involved a crash, 3 involved a fire, 14 reported injuries, and none reported deaths.
